Plugin authors implement a single `Sink` interface; Tailgate handles cursoring, backoff, and batching. Plugins must not assume ordering across shards — only within a shard. Backpressure is signaled by returning `SinkBusy`, after which Tailgate pauses the shard and retries with jittered delays. You may override defaults per plugin via the manifest, but staying within the supported ranges keeps behavior predictable across versions. The default tuning constants are:

constants for hahof-bajep:
THRESHOLDS = {
    "sorwyn": 797,
    "jorath": 933,
    "pramir": 998,
    "wenath": 950,
    "silok": 489,
    "prawyn": 572,
    "praiel": 821,
}

Heads up, future maintainers: the Furrowlink gateway ingests telemetry from tractors and balers over a flaky rural LTE mesh, so expect bursts of duplicate packets after connectivity gaps. The dedupe window is 90 seconds — don't shorten it, we tried, it was bad. If the ingest queue backs up past 50k messages, restart the consumer pods one at a time, never all at once. The restart procedure and queue dashboards are documented on the internal runbook page.

runbook for badug-kadup: https://confluence.zemvarlabs.internal/projects/browse/display/projects/bd1b

## Changelog: Keyfall password reset revamp — default changes

For this week's eng sync: the Keyfall reset flow revamp shipped Tuesday with several changed defaults. Reset tokens now expire after 15 minutes instead of 60, single-use enforcement is on by default, and the rate limiter tightened from 10 to 3 attempts per hour per account. Email templates moved to the Lanternly sender. Downstream services should reconcile against the new defaults, which are as follows.

service settings:
[casax]
port = 6379
team = rusir
host = casax.zemvarhq.corp
region = outer-4
access_code = ac_9808ce
timeout_ms = 1500